Questions on multibranch pipeline

I have few questions regarding the multibranch pipeline. If anyone could help it would be great

1. How to build, test, and deploy only one branch out of n branches.

2. How to configure webhook so that as soon as the changes were done to the branch Jenkins knows that and starts the next step.
Oct 27 in Jenkins by anonymous
Configuring Jenkins with git branch repository for ci/cd purposes..will help to solve your need I think.

So when any changes are made to the code, Jenkins polls the changes to the repository and will run a build.
answered Oct 27 by Hana

